We are currently on Equinox in the Caribbean. Every single port of call has only allowed vaccinated passengers to go ashore (except for unvaccinated children traveling with their parents who must take ship sponsored tours). Every tour guide, bus driver, vendor, and restaurant worker we have seen is wearing a mask. 
 

These ports included St. Croix, Antigua, Dominica, St. Lucia, and we will find out in the next two days about Aruba and Curaçao. I imagine it will be much the same. 
 

All if this could change by the time your cruise sets sail, but for now, this it what we experienced.
